Congressman Tom Emmer (MN-06) issued the following statement regarding the House of Representatives passage of the $1.9 trillion COVID-19 package: "Over the last year, Congress has adopted five COVID relief packages in a bipartisan fashion. Despite President Biden's promise to work across the aisle and bring our country out of this pandemic, he has chosen to side with Speaker Pelosi in an entirely partisan fashion to advance a political agenda. Only 9% of the funding in today's bill goes towards fighting the virus. Instead, it prioritizes funding for government bailouts ahead of returning our students to the classroom and reopening our economy. With more than $1 trillion in previous COVID relief still left unspent, today's vote cuts a $2 trillion check that our children and grandchildren will be forced to cash."
Rep. Tom Emmer
